I got the opportunity to conduct my internship in Sydney International School which is an English medium school, situated in Baridhara, Dhaka, Bangladesh for twelve weeks. During the period, I observed some classes as well as took the languages classes of year six. I learned different aspects of teaching through the experience of working there. Among all the teaching aspects, I focused writing materials design for language classes in this internship report. In the report, I discussed about different types of materials, the procedure of preparing materials, writing materials with integrated skills and also materials for writing assessment. Furthermore, I shared my experience of preparing writing materials demonstrating some examples as well as the obstacles I faced during working there. Finally, I concluded the report providing some recommendation.
